Your daily dose of news, insights, and information.
Unlock the secrets of HTML5 and create stunning web wonders effortlessly! Dive in and transform your web design skills today!
HTML5 has revolutionized web development with its numerous features that enhance the user experience. Among the 10 amazing HTML5 features you might not be aware of, Geolocation API stands out. This feature allows web applications to access the geographical location of a user, making it easier to provide personalized content and services based on the user’s location.
Another remarkable feature of HTML5 is the Canvas element which enables dynamic, scriptable rendering of 2D shapes and images. This opens up a world of possibilities for developers to create games, animations, and interactive graphs right in the browser, eliminating the need for third-party plugins. These HTML5 innovations not only enhance functionality but also contribute to a more engaging and interactive web experience.
Creating interactive web applications has become increasingly important in the modern web development landscape. With HTML5, developers gain access to a plethora of tools and technologies that enable the construction of dynamic user interfaces. To get started, you should familiarize yourself with the new features offered in HTML5, such as the semantic elements, the canvas API, and the Geolocation API. These elements not only enhance interactivity but also improve accessibility and SEO.
To create an interactive web application, start by structuring your HTML with semantic tags for better SEO and readability. Next, incorporate CSS3 to style your application and add animations that captivate users. Finally, use JavaScript in conjunction with HTML5 APIs to increase functionality. For instance, using the Web Audio API allows you to incorporate sound for more immersive experiences. Keep in mind to regularly test your application for performance and compatibility across different devices and browsers.
HTML5 represents a significant leap forward from previous versions of HTML, offering features that enhance the capabilities of web development. One of the most notable changes is the introduction of new semantic elements such as <header>
, <footer>
, and <article>
, which improve the structure and meaning of web pages. These elements make it easier for search engines to understand the content of a page, ultimately aiding in Search Engine Optimization (SEO). Additionally, HTML5 comes with built-in support for multimedia elements like <video>
and <audio>
, enabling developers to embed rich content without relying on third-party plugins. This shift not only improves load times but also enhances user experience.
Another critical aspect of HTML5 is its focus on device independence. It supports responsive design, allowing web pages to adjust seamlessly across various screen sizes and orientations. This capability is particularly important in today's mobile-first world, where mobile usage continues to grow. As a result, websites built on HTML5 are more accessible to a broader audience. Furthermore, HTML5 introduces APIs like the Canvas
for drawing graphics and the Geolocation
API for sharing user locations. These advancements open new avenues for interactive applications, underscoring why transitioning to HTML5 is not just beneficial, but essential for modern web development.